Course Objectives | The goal of this course is to foster a research-oriented mindset and equip doctoral students with the requisite knowledge and experience in electrical and electronics engineering. All doctoral students are obligated to enroll in this course. Course requirements include presenting seminars on their dissertation research |

Course Content | Each PhD student is expected to give a presentation on his/her thesis work and attend the seminars conducted by other students and academic staff. |
